An Important Contribution To The History Of 19Thcentury English Liberalism And Postreform Politics, This Book Argues That The Whig Party Was Dominated By A New Generation Of Politicians After 1832 Who Actively Sponsored Legislation Designed To Transform The Constitution From An Exclusively Anglican Document To A Nonsectarian, Yet Christian One. Brent Demonstrates That This Concern For Religious Toleration And The Preoccupation With Ecclesiastical Issues Were Central To Whiggery In This Period, And That The Questions Raised During These Years Were Posed Only To Dominate Victorian Politics For The Generation To Come.
